Giant Robot started as this small punk-rock zine featuring Asian and Asian American alternative and pop culture, but grew to become a celebrated art and cultural institution. How did Giant Robot survive? How have its founders maintained their passion and lifestyle throughout all their life changes and challenges? May 16, 2016.

A podcast about slices of distinctly Asian American culture and history. What is Asian Americana? Asian Americana is a podcast about slices of distinctly Asian American culture and history. Asian Americana is also a term based on the idea that Asian Americans are a rich and inherent part of the American cultural and historical tapestry. We weren't just present; we've actively built and shaped this nation with endless stories and contributions. This is Asian Americana. Who's behind Asian Americana?

Is a program that connects Hmong farmers in California’s central valley with Asian American communities in Southern California. How does this program empower communities in determining their own path to health and economic sustainability? We’ll find out by visiting both ends of our food’s journey from farmer to consumer. Chinese Americans shaped the physical landscape of California during its early history in a way that still impacts us today. We explore how Chinese Americans developed the Sacramento delta, their role in California's growth, and visit Locke, a town founded by Chinese Americans. Nov 12, 2016. Nov 12, 2016. Aug 5, 2016. The Mission of the Philadelphia Police Asian American Advisory Committee is to act as the liaison between the Philadelphia Police Department and the various Asian American Communities in the City of Philadelphia. In their roles as PPAAAC members, the envoys will facilitate communication, understanding and cooperation between the Asian American Communities and the Philadelphia Police Department to improve the quality of life for our residents and visitors.
